DNS(Domain Name System,域名系统)是将域名转换成IP地址的系统,它对于互联网的正常运行至关重要。在进行网站建设的过程中,DNS配置也是最为基础的一步,因此本文将从多个角度分析DNS配置。
1. DNS的作用
DNS的主要作用是将用户输入的网址转换成与之对应的IP地址,使网站能够被正确访问。如果没有DNS服务器,用户将无法访问任何网站。同时,在局域网中也需要使用DNS,将计算机名转换成IP地址,方便内网通信。
2. DNS的分类
DNS分为本地DNS和公共DNS,本地DNS主要是针对公司或家庭内部网络的进行配置;公共DNS则是默认情况下的DNS,是由运营商或互联网服务提供商提供的。同时,也可以选择使用第三方DNS服务,如Google DNS、OpenDNS等。
3. DNS的配置方法
在进行DNS配置时,需要设置DNS服务器的IP地址。对于Windows系统,可以在“网络和共享中心”中的“更改适配器设置”,找到需要配置的网络适配器,再进行属性设置。对于Mac OS X系统,则是在“系统偏好设置”中找到“网络”,再点击“高级”,进行DNS设置。对于Linux系统,则需要修改/etc/resolv.conf文件进行DNS配置。
4. DNS的优化
如果DNS服务器的响应速度较慢,可能会影响网站的访问速度。因此,可以通过修改DNS服务器来进行DNS优化。可以选择使用国内较快的DNS服务商,如114DNS、联通DNS等。同时,也可以使用“智能DNS”,它会为用户选择最快的服务器进行响应。
5. DNS的故障排除
当DNS配置出现问题时,可能会导致网站无法正常访问。在排查故障时,可以先进行网络连接测试以确定网络是否正常连接。如果网络连接正常,可以尝试查看DNS服务器的连接状态,检查是否有误配置。同时也可以尝试使用其他DNS服务器进行测试,确定是DNS问题还是其他问题。